? The CLARITY Act: Clearing the Fog, or Just Moving It Around?
Congress’s big hope is the CLARITY Act, a legislative attempt to define which digital assets fall under SEC or CFTC oversight. The idea? Shift crypto commodities-think Bitcoin-from the tangled SEC web to the CFTC’s jurisdiction, making life easier for certain players. Sounds neat, right? But hold up.
Critics argue the Act creates loopholes for “regulatory arbitrage,” where projects rebrand their assets just enough to dodge SEC regulations. Plus, the CFTC’s track record is mostly on derivatives, less so on retail protection or spot commodity exchanges [2]. This leaves a heap of questions about the CFTC’s readiness to guard the everyday investor. And honestly, some folks worry it weakens securities laws, increasing systemic risks.

?️ Risk Management Rules: Banks Don’t Want to Be the Weakest Link
July 2025 brought joint guidance from Federal Reserve, OCC, and FDIC clarifying crypto-asset safekeeping rules for banks. The play here is risk management, baby. Banks now have to independently assess operational, legal, and fraud risks tied to crypto custody-no more hand-holding.
This guidance steered institutions towards a “principles-based oversight” approach, shifting from rigid rules to flexible scrutiny calibrated by risk profile [4]. It’s like saying, “Look, you’re responsible for your own crypto mess now.”
This move is a double-edged sword: helping well-prepared players thrive while pushing out smaller outfits lacking compliance muscle.

Q1: What are crypto asset-backed securities, and why does regulation matter?
A1: Crypto ABS are financial products backed by digital assets like Bitcoin or Ethereum. Regulation matters because it affects their legal standing, investor protections, and market acceptance.
Q2: How does the CLARITY Act affect crypto asset classification?
A2: The Act tries to split crypto assets between SEC securities and CFTC commodities, aiming to clarify oversight but leaving some risks and definitions ambiguous.
Q3: How do SEC enforcement actions influence crypto market volatility?
A3: Enforcement often triggers price drops and liquidation cascades, increasing market volatility and impacting the value of underlying crypto collateral.
Q4: Why are institutional investors cautious about crypto asset-backed securities?
A4: Regulatory uncertainty and liquidity concerns make institutions hesitant to fully commit, despite the potential for higher returns.
Q5: What role do banks play in managing risks around crypto asset custody?
A5: Banks must now rigorously assess and mitigate legal, operational, and fraud risks tied to holding crypto assets, following updated federal guidance.
Q6: Can clearer regulations boost adoption of crypto asset-backed securities?
A6: Yes, clearer rules could increase investor confidence and capital inflows but require balanced enforcement to avoid stifling innovation.
